Exploring Beeses: Britain’s Most Remote Pub

Located on the banks of the River Avon in Bristol, Beeses Riverside Bar is a unique and secluded pub known for being one of the most remote in the UK. The journey to reach this hidden gem involves traversing a narrow, bumpy lane or arriving by ferry through the picturesque waterways.

Established in 1846 as a tea garden, Beeses offers a serene setting next to the Eastwood Farm nature reserve and Conham River Park. Visitors can savor their experience by arriving via the private jetty or enjoying the tranquil tiered garden and decking.

The pub’s seasonal reopening brings live music performances and a menu featuring a selection of draught options such as Bristol Beer Factory Infinity Helles Lager and North Street Cider. While prices are on the higher end, the unique atmosphere and offerings make Beeses a delightful destination for those seeking a memorable riverside retreat.
